Council's Community Strengthening Grants Program has been a valuable source of financial support for local events and projects in Golden Plains Shire communities for over 26 years.

Grants of up to $7,000 are available in three streams:
1. Healthy Connected Community

2. Community Inclusion

3. Environment and Sustainability

Before completing this grant application form, you must have read and understood the Community Strengthening Grants Standard Guidelines. Please click here to view the 2026 Community Strengthening Grants Guidelines.

  • If you have any questions regarding the eligibility criteria, please contact Community Development and Grants Officer on 5220 7111 or email: communitygrants@gplains.vic.gov.au.
  • Incomplete applications and/or applications received after the closing date will not be considered.
  • 2026 Community Strengthening Grants opens on 1st August 2026 and closes at 2pm on 31st August 2026.
